Cinema release: FASSBINDER – a documentary by Annekatrin Hendel


Fassbinder 17 04 15 rechtsOn 30 April Annekatrin Hendel’s documentary FASSBINDER, produced by IT WORKS! Medien in cooperation with the Rainer Werner Fassbinder Foundation and based on an idea by Juliane Maria Lorenz, is being released in German cinemas. In the film Hendel traces the development of Fassbinder’s career without drawing a strict dividing line between life and art. She explores the roots of the rage of New German Cinema’s enfant terrible and of the brashness, determination and assertiveness he needed to become the artist he did. Hendel has already made a name for herself as a director with ambitious documentaries such as VATERLANDSVERRÄTER (Traitors to the Fatherland) and ANDERSON. FASSBINDER features the voices not only of friends and colleagues of Fassbinder’s such as Irm Hermann, Margit Carstensen, Harry Baer, Hanna Schygulla, Volker Schlöndorff and Juliane Maria Lorenz but also and above all the subject himself – in autobiographical scenes from his films, rare interviews and passages from his early literary work. Using hitherto unpublished material, Hendel provides a fresh insight into one of the most important artists of the twentieth century.

Before the documentary’s general release in German cinemas, it will premiere in Berlin’s Volksbühne on 27 April. The documentary will be premiered on television by the German-French broadcaster ARTE on 27 May.
